    Only A Matter Of Time

    September 3, 2009 /

    So, it’s here! I got a first listen to Carrie Underwood’s new single, “Cowboy Casanova”, which I absolutely loved!! The song, an uptempo-foot stomper, will sure to be the hottest song of the fall. On Underwood’s previous two albums, she has released ballads as her lead singles, while this time she definitely shows off her inner Shania and pulls out a showstopper. Carrie, the current ACM Entertainer Of The Year, is gunning for that top stop again and she may just have it on lock with this new album. It is definitely shaping up to be one of excellence.     Get Ready to "Play On"

    August 31, 2009 /

    Carrie Underwood unveiled the cover and title to her 3rd album, due out November 3rd – a week before she co-hosts the Country Music Awards with Brad Paisley. The album, titled Play On, is going to be produced by Mark Bright, who produced her previous efforts Carnival Ride and her debut, Some Hearts, which has been certified 7x platinum and is the best selling debut album from a female country singer in history. Underwood has been working with some great writers for this new album and it should be interesting to see how it all comes together. It seems the album may take a stab at more crossover hits, with…
